CD45其胞浆区段具有蛋白质酪氨酸磷酸酶的作用,能使底物P56lck和P59fyn上酪氨酸脱磷酸而激活,在细胞的信息传导中发挥重要作用,CD45是细胞膜上信号传导的关键分子,在淋巴细胞的发育成熟,功能调节及信号传递中具有重要意义,CD45的分布可作为某些T细胞亚群的分类标志。同时CD45分子在所有白细胞上都有...
